Juventus forward Cristiano Ronaldo, Real Madrid's Luka Modric and Liverpool's Mo Salah have been shortlisted for the men's European Football of the Year award.

Barcelona star Lionel Messi is the obvious exclusion from the list, despite leading his side to another dominant league win in Spain.

Ronaldo, who won the award last year, led Real Madrid to a third consecutive Champions League trophy last season, before joining Juventus in the off-season.

Modric, who was also part of the Champions League-winning Real side, won the best player award at the World Cup, as Croatia finished runners-up overall.

Meanwhile, Salah scored 44 goals for Liverpool across all competitions, as they fell to Real Madrid in the final of the Champions League.

The award will be presented at a ceremony on August 30.
